Painting Description
"Winter Scene With Figures On Frozen Lake" is a captivating painting by the Dutch artist Adrianus Koekkoek Marianus, a member of the renowned Koekkoek family of painters. This artwork exemplifies the 19th-century Dutch Romantic style, characterized by its meticulous attention to detail and evocative portrayal of nature. The painting depicts a quintessential winter landscape, where a frozen lake serves as the central element around which the scene unfolds.
In "Winter Scene With Figures On Frozen Lake," Marianus masterfully captures the essence of a serene winter day. The composition is populated with figures engaging in various activities on the ice, from ice skating to socializing, which brings a lively and dynamic quality to the otherwise tranquil setting. The figures are dressed in period-appropriate winter attire, adding a historical dimension to the piece. The artist's use of light and shadow enhances the crispness of the winter air and the reflective quality of the ice, creating a sense of depth and realism.
The background features a picturesque village with snow-covered rooftops and trees, further enriching the narrative of the painting. The sky, painted in soft hues, suggests either the early morning or late afternoon, adding to the overall mood of calm and peacefulness. Marianus's technique showcases his ability to blend fine detail with broader, more impressionistic strokes, a hallmark of his artistic style.
Adrianus Koekkoek Marianus, born in 1811, was part of a distinguished lineage of artists, with his father Johannes Hermanus Koekkoek and his brothers also being notable painters. His works often focused on landscapes and maritime scenes, reflecting the natural beauty of the Netherlands. "Winter Scene With Figures On Frozen Lake" stands as a testament to his skill in capturing the serene and picturesque aspects of Dutch life, making it a valuable piece in the study of 19th-century European art.
